The Oulton Raidettes Women's Rugby League Club are a women's rugby league football team based in Leeds, West Yorkshire. They were founded in 2012 and have affiliations with the Oulton Raiders.[1] As of 2025 they play in the RFL Women's Championship.

History

[edit]

In 2012, the team played in the Yorkshire and North East Division and made their first appearance in the Women's Challenge Cup where they played Wigan St Patricks in the first round.[2] The league system was restructured several times in the following seasons with Oulton competing in Division One in 2013[3] and, from 2015, in the Premier Division which was the top tier of the RFL Women's Rugby League.[4] In 2016 and 2017, before the group format was introduced to the Challenge Cup, Oulton reached the quarter-finals of the competition.[5][6] In 2017, Oulton competed in the Championship and reached the Grand Final in the first season of the competition.[7]

In April 2022, Oulton defeated Wakefield Trinity 14–12 in their final group match to progress to the quarter-finals of the Challenge Cup.[8] In October 2022, Oulton defeated the Salford Red Devils 33–14 in the Championship Grand Final,[9] but declined promotion to the 2023 Super League.[10] In 2023, Oulton reached the Championship Grand Final again, but lost 30–16 to Hull Kingston Rovers.[11] In January 2024, following the restructuring of the women's league pyramid, it was announced that Oulton would be in the Northern Women's Championship.[12] They finished the season in fourth place to qualify for the play-offs, but forfeited their semi-final match due to players having other commitments, including several of them being in France as part of England Rugby League's Diploma in Sporting Excellence (DiSE) programme.[13][14]
